Calculate Log Base 261 of 371

To solve the equation log 261 (371)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 371, a = 261:
    log 261 (371) = log(371) / log(261)
  3. Evaluate the term:
    log(371) / log(261)
    = 1.39794000867204 / 1.92427928606188
    = 1.0632007126476
    = Logarithm of 371 with base 261
